ACCESS MEDICAL CLINIC
Location
Blytheville, Arkansas
The LPN Float will provide clinical support across multiple clinic locations by monitoring vital signs, performing phlebotomy, and administering medications. They are also responsible for accurate EMR documentation, patient education, and maintaining compliance with HIPAA standards.
Candidates must hold a current, unrestricted LPN license and a valid driver's license with an acceptable driving record. A high school diploma and current BLS certification are required, along with the ability to travel regularly between assigned clinic sites.
